請問要怎樣設定權限才能不讓人家看到目錄內容



贊助商連結


Socrates
2002-12-26, 09:43 PM
如題
我是用Apache+WinXP架的伺服器
我是過更改httpd.conf裡面的<Directory />
可是還是不知道要怎麼改才能達到我要的目的???

嗯~~我的意思就是...
例如http://www.aa.com.tw/ww/index.htm
如果index.htm不存在時
網址輸入http://www.aa.com.tw/ww/並不會出現檔案列表
這要要怎麼達成呢???

謝謝啦!!!

贊助商連結


nyker
2002-12-26, 10:20 PM
將Indexes這個字串刪掉就行了!:D

<Directory />
.....
Options ... Indexes
.....
</Directory>

june3838
2002-12-26, 10:32 PM
最初由 nyker 發表
將Indexes這個字串刪掉就行了!:D

<Directory />
.....
#Options ... Indexes
.....
</Directory>

用#把那行註解比較好。

Socrates
2002-12-27, 12:30 AM
我把它改成
<Directory />
# Options None
AllowOverride None
</Directory>
可是還是一樣耶....
我有重新啟動Apache了....

對了~~~每個資料夾都要設定嗎??
子目錄的權限會不會繼承母目錄呀????
再次謝謝囉!!!

luckyboys
2003-01-11, 03:18 PM
在網站根目錄放.htaccess這個檔案,檔案中寫上類似上述的語法,就可以了:D
不用每個目錄都去設定!